What is a doula?
A doula is a trained professional who provides continuous emotional, physical, and informational support during pregnancy, labor, and the postpartum period. Unlike medical providers, doulas focus on comfort, confidence in both the birthing mother and partner, and helping families feel informed and empowered. A doula offers personalized care tailored to your birth preferences—whether you’re planning a hospital birth, birth center delivery, or home birth. The evidence on doulas have shown to enhance the entire labor and birth experience by reducing unnecessary interventions and offering steady emotional and physical support for both the birthing mother and her partner. While nurses, midwives, and loved ones play important roles, studies consistently show that dedicated doula support has a uniquely positive impact. The evidence on doulas have shown to enhance the entire labor and birth experience by reducing unnecessary interventions and offering steady emotional and physical support for both the birthing mother and her partner. While nurses, midwives, and loved ones play important roles, studies consistently show that dedicated doula support has a uniquely positive impact. Studies have shown the following benefits:
• 31% decrease in the risk of being dissatisfied with the birth experience
• 38% decrease in the baby’s risk of a low five-minute APGAR score
• Shorter labors by 41 minutes on average
• 10% decrease in the use of any medications for pain relief
• Fewer medical interventions such as Pitocin
• Increase in the likelihood of a spontaneous vaginal birth (decreased inductions)
• May decrease the chance of Cesarean by 39%
• Better breastfeeding outcomes
